Residents who live in the city receive power from the city's power plant. If the city is a square, approximately how wide is the city if the area is 200 square miles?

Answer:

width = 14.14 sq.miles

Explanation:

We are told that the city is square.. We are also told that the area of the city is 200 sq.miles.

Now,formula for area of square if a side is x is given as;

A = x²

Where x is both the length and width.

Thus;

x² = 200

x = √200

x = 14.14 sq.miles

Thus,length = 14.14 sq.miles and width = 14.14 sq.miles
